I was wondering if anyone has used the Roverguage and Protune software to fine tune the 14CUX ECU? I have the LED readout for the fault codes on my 1994 +8 14CUX but have never attempted to obtain a more detailed readout or make any adjustments. Thanks.

I have used the Roverguage software to extract a ROM image. Then I have modified the contents and blown a new ROM. I was only changing some of the diagnostic code as I wanted to enable the MIL light (also need to amend wiring). I have steered clear of amending fueling as I spent a few years getting an Omex fuel map correct and have the badge, and scars. I do have an early version of a Blackbox MSV which will talk to the 14CUX, the immobiliser, and also the GEMs, only downside was the price.
